Just trying to get a chuckle with the Lottery question. Listen to some or most of these guys. They can lead you in the right direction and it is much cheaper to buy a running already built combo. The WIN THE LOTTERY statement was to bring some insight to other expenses such as travel, gas or diesel for the tow vehicle, motels or motor home costs, entry fees and NHRA insurance for things like golf carts, pit bikes, etc,, time away from work, upkeep etc. It was much less expensive when I did it back in the 1970's. Entry fees then for the Sports Nationals and the Gator Nationals was only $40 for each and that included car, driver, and one pit crew.There are a lot of great guys and women who race the stock and sportsman classes. Listen to them as most will not steer you wrong. Nothing in life is free but we only get one chance at life. Go for it if its affordable to you.

I believe you can get a nice stocker and be racing for less than 15k, in some cases 10k.

Before you start you have to contact the NHRA and get a permanent number and membership. You'll get a permanent number card which will also serve as "license" of sorts. Your permanent number and class must be applied to the car with paint or stickers (no shoe polish).

When you enter your first divisional you'll be teched and all your safety equipment will be checked (belts, clothing, etc.). Get a rule book.

You'll only get torn down if you set a record or you're protested. Teardowns are random at Indy. Of course, there is always a threat of any unannounced teardown at any event but that rarely occurs.
